- The show was renewed for seasons 35 & 36 in January 2023. This will bring them to 801 episodes. (Entertainment Weekly, Matt Selman)
- Upcoming plot: Marge's self-image in the town that everyone thinks she's a good person is at stake when Homer and Marge have to respond to a kidnapping and extortion situation. The kidnappers have not yet been decided on, but they’re thinking of Jimbo and Shauna. (Defector, 14:22) [12/12/23]
- An upcoming episode will reference a courtroom scene from Anatomy of a Fall. (Springfield Googolplex podcast, 54:00) [7/5/2024]
- Four episodes will be exclusive to Disney+ (the double-sized episode "O, C'mon All Ye Faithful" counts as two). They were produced as part of the season 35 production season. (TVLine, Carolyn Omine, Michael Price) [8/10-8/12]
- Upcoming guest star directed by Al Jean: Sidse Babett Knudsen (Al Jean) [9/18]
- Upcoming guest star John DiMaggio (playing an original character) (Lights Camera Jackson 15:40) [9/24]
- Al Jean is working on an idea about Willie posting on OnlyFans, but isn't sure if it'll come to fruition. (Mama's Geeky, 3:39)
- Pamela Hayden, the voice of Milhouse, has retired. Production-wise, the last episode she recorded was "O C'mon All Ye Faithful," but she also recorded for "The Past and the Furious" and "Yellow Planet." (Carolyn Omine)[11/21]
- An additional four episodes (produced as part of the season 36 production season) will be exclusive to Disney+. (Give Me My Remote) [12/9]
